Patient Service Representative

On-siteMount Pleasant, South Carolina, United States

Full Time

Job Summary

Register patients, answer the telephone, and schedule appointments while collecting payments and posting charges daily. Screen visitors, maintain office equipment and supplies, and ensure all faxes and mail are cleared and distributed. Verify demographic and insurance information, complete registration forms, and balance daily transactions according to policy. Greet patients as they arrive, facilitate referral requests and test scheduling, and assist clinical staff with emergency services and patient flow. Maintain patient confidentiality, comply with HIPAA and cybersecurity protocols, and complete required training such as CPR and OSHA.
